My name is Esther and I am fundraising on behave of the Queer and Trans Community residing in Kakuma Refugee camp in northern Kenya.
To ellaborate more, Kakuma Refugee camp hosts refugees from over 100 countries with different cultures, beliefs and religions. Amongst them are the LGBTQ+ refugees who are not welcomed in the community and face violence and discrimination from the other refugees.
A few months ago, I was contacted by a young gay Ugandan man named Eric Masagazi (his names are used with verbal consent), who was looking for help and ideas from other Queer people from around the world to raise funds as a way to protect his community in the camp.
Throughout this time, he has documented and shared with me some of the horrific conditions that they face. Though entitled to water, food, and education in the camp, many in the Queer and Trans Community are either violently attacked (including with weapons like machetes, stones etc), or forcefully excluded by the general population. The most vulnerable of this group are the children. These children are the children of Lesbian mothers who were either forced into marriage or victims of "corrective" rape. Even though they are entitled to go to school, these children are physically and verbally abused by the children of the other refugees because their mothers are "Devil Lesbians". The LGBTQ+ refugee Children are scared to go to school or even play outside. They are constantly living in fear.
The Homo-Transphobia has become so bad that people are being attacked with sticks and machetes. Night patrols have been created to prevent their tents and makeshift homes and property from being burned.
Recently, a little boy, whose mother is a Lesbian, was poisoned and had to spend a week in the hospital. He almost died. And this is just to name a few.
